weekend update

little tokyo mitsuwa is going out of business, so starting 1/19, everything is 50% off. doors opens at 9:30am but...
...when we got there, the line was already 1 1/2 blocks long. when we were driving to its parking structure, the streets was crowded with cars all going to mitsuwa. luckly we parked on the street a few blocks away and walked down. but when we got there, the line was hella long and snaked around. there was security there to let a certain amount of people in at a time (to avoid the walmart black friday incident). we waited in line for about 45 minutes until we decided that by the time we get in, there would be nothing left. we were hoping to get a small rice cooker but when i looked in the window, i saw all the applicances, produce, fish, and pretty much anything good, was gone. people probably waited till 7pm to get anything good.

when people left the store, i would see what they had bought so i would know what was left in the store. a few people came out with bags of rice, but i think those ran out quick and others was left with cups-o-noodles.
